Gen Con, the leading and longest-running tabletop gaming convention in North America, is set to open its doors on July 30th in Indianapolis, offering enthusiasts a first look at the latest innovations in board games. The event's central Exhibition Hall will feature numerous vendors from around the globe, presenting their newest creations. While free demonstrations will be available throughout the weekend, many popular items are expected to sell out quickly as attendees eager to secure games that will not be widely distributed for several months queue up for early access.

For those attending Gen Con in Indianapolis, a curated selection of ten highly anticipated games, including exciting adaptations from popular franchises like Star Trek and The Lord of the Rings, awaits discovery. Notable titles include "Abroad," a strategic European travel game; "Ants," an intricate engine-builder making its North American debut; "Container," a revived economic simulation; "Drillers," an underground exploration adventure; "Entropy," a universe-building game; "Hacienda," an ecological development game; "The Lord of the Rings: Circle of Conflict," a real-time strategy game; "Shards of Creation," a trick-taking card game based on Brandon Sanderson's Cosmere; "Star Trek: Space Hunt," a chaotic real-time submarine combat adaptation; and "Wingspan Pocket," a simplified version of the popular bird-themed game. For those unable to attend or who miss out on the initial sales, preorder options are provided to facilitate easier purchasing.

Pokopia's Aquatic Event: Fetching Scales for Feebas
The Pokémon Company has announced an upcoming limited-time in-game event for Pokopia, starting next month. Titled 'Fetching Scales for Feebas,' the event will run from August 13th to August 28th. Players will be tasked with collecting Prism Scales for Feebas, which can then be exchanged for unique furniture items to enhance their game experience. This event coincides with other water-themed content, including a free update and the Expansion Pass: Part 1 DLC, set to arrive on August 5th, making for a busy period for Pokopia enthusiasts.

GOG's Next Preservation Project: NOX, the ARPG Eclipsed by Diablo 2
GOG has announced that Westwood's 2000 ARPG, NOX, has won its latest patron poll for the Preservation Program. This means GOG will ensure the game remains supported and easily playable. Despite its original release coinciding with Diablo 2, NOX secured over 3,000 votes, significantly ahead of its closest competitor. The game is currently available on GOG at a discounted price for a limited time.
